远程连接MySQL报错1045解决方案

MySQL远端操作步骤:

方法一:

  1. USE mysql
  2. G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;
  3. FLUSH PRIVILEGES;

注意:第二步中的password为你要设置的 root登录密码,注意并不是远端安装时的root密码,你在此设置何密码,则远程登录为何密码;
以此类推,其他用户也如此操作。


方法二:改表法

mysql> use mysql; 
mysql> update user set host = '%' where user = 'root'; 
mysql> select host, user from user; 
mysql> flush privileges;
posted @ 2019-11-11 22:18  超级小白龙  阅读(1526)  评论(1编辑  收藏  举报